如何在TypeScript中定义函数并转换成JS中的函数

类似JavaScript,TypeScript也可以定义和调用函数,只不过需要指定函数参数的数据类型和函数返回值的类型,并且数据类型要保持一致。下面利用具体的实例说明,操作如下:

如何在TypeScript中定义函数并转换成JS中的函数

第一步:新建TypeScript文件

首先,在已打开的HBuilder工具中,新建一个TypeScript文件。在该文件中,我们将定义一个名为mulNum的函数。代码如下:

function mulNum(x: number, y: number): number {    return x * y;}

第二步:调用函数并打印结果

接下来,在函数的下方调用mulNum函数,并传入两个数值类型的参数。通过console.log()函数打印函数的返回结果。代码如下:

console.log(mulNum(2, 3));

第三步:生成JS文件并引入HTML页面

直接运行TypeScript文件,HBuilder会自动生成同名的JS文件。接着,新建一个HTML5页面,并在该页面中引入刚生成的JS文件。

lt;htmlgt;lt;headgt;    lt;script src"mulNum.js"gt;lt;/scriptgt;lt;/headgt;lt;bodygt;    lt;scriptgt;        console.log(mulNum(2, 3));    lt;/scriptgt;lt;/bodygt;lt;/htmlgt;

第四步:预览结果

保存HTML文件并在浏览器中打开,打开浏览器控制台,查看打印结果。

第五步:使用另一种方式声明函数

在TypeScript中,还可以使用另一种方式来声明函数。代码如下:

let mulNum  (x: number, y: number): number > {    return x * y;}

第六步:再次运行并查看结果

保存修改后的TypeScript文件,并再次运行HTML页面,查看浏览器控制台中的打印结果。

标签:

最新文章

  1. 什么是蛙泳膝盖内扣 蛙泳翻脚及改正方法?2025-03-24
  2. 燕窝没有溯源码能买吗 溯源燕窝好吗?2025-03-26
  3. 域名注册 速卖通前景怎么样?2025-03-26
  4. windows7怎么开热点 Windows 7开启热点教程2025-03-16
  5. 2048球球碰碰乐赚钱游戏下载 2048经典游戏的玩法规律是怎样玩的?2025-03-27
  6. 网络运营 怎么样做好网站的 SEO 优化?2025-03-26
  7. 如何把京东优惠券链接提取出来2025-03-15
  8. 屏南有摩托车驾校吗(学摩托车驾照去哪里报名?)2025-03-23
  9. 公司做网站哪家好 长春哪家网络公司做网站专业?2025-03-29
  10. 澳大利亚红酒排名图片 澳洲三大红酒品牌?2025-03-22
  11. 小米手机快捷键小圆点怎么设置2025-03-12
  12. flash字体alpha如何设置 flash怎么让图片闪烁?2025-03-14
  13. 网址每一部分的含义 什么样的域名是好域名?2025-03-31
  14. 如何开通微信公众号 如何申请微信公众号?2025-03-28
  15. Word文档如何让插入的上凸带形没有填充颜色2025-03-12
  16. 豆浆能拿来做面膜吗(鲜豆浆做面膜的好处?)2025-03-24
  17. tl-wdr5620怎么进路由器设置界面 tl一wdr5620路由器线怎么插?2025-03-23
  18. 如何使用U盘安装原版XP系统2025-03-10
  19. 产品页面设计 网页设计合适的页面尺寸是多少?2025-03-28
  20. 潮州哪有宠物店(潮州哪里有卖宠物犬呢?)2025-03-24
  21. win10系统变量path误删 如何使用命令设置和查看windows的环境变量?2025-03-29
  22. 美团常驻区域设置技巧 乐跑外卖如果超出区域还会不会派单?2025-03-13
  23. 正则匹配逗号分隔的数字 正则表达式怎么匹配逗号?2025-03-29
  24. 解决Mac安全性偏好设置问题:打开被阻拦的应用2025-03-14
  25. 如何在Word中插入空格线2025-03-09
  26. 南昌门诊部要办营业执照吗 备案制诊所需要办营业执照吗?2025-03-20
  27. Word中如何修改度量单位2025-03-12
  28. 奇瑞车联网系统收费吗 奇瑞雄狮50车机系统怎么样?2025-03-23
  29. 支付宝收款码提醒功能如何开启2025-03-14
  30. php回复功能实现 php mysql,评论回复功能怎么实现?2025-03-26
优质自媒体
优质自媒体 微信号:优质自媒体 扫描二维码关注公众号
优质自媒体

小编推荐

  1. 1 怎么打开电脑允许连接共享文件 手机如何访问电脑局域网共享的文件夹?

    手机如何访问电脑局域网共享的文件夹?假如你是Windows设备,你不需要先在电脑的控制面板a8网络和网络共享中心a8初级共享设置中中启动「网络突然发现」和「禁用文件和打印机互相访问」。2后再在电脑空白文档一个文件夹或建议使用2个装甲旅文件夹

  2. 2 svn如何设置只能读写自己的文件 svn如何拉出分支?

    svn如何拉出分支?svn晃出分支步骤不胜感激:1、命令行的话,拉分是svn内容复制。2、TortoiseSVN客户端的话,你在源文件夹点右键,右键菜单中选择TortoiseSVN——“分支/标记”,在弹出窗口的“至URL”栏中填上分支存放

  3. 3 catia中文版怎么转英文 启动catia时显示“热启动不可用”是什么意思?

    启动catia时显示“热启动不可用”是什么意思?我猜你用的是中文界面,也就是说你用的是中文版。如果你把软件改成英文,就不会出现这种情况。 "不可用的热启动和会导致某些模块中的某些功能不可用。我不 我不知道它的确切原因,但我认为这是由于不完整

  4. 4 微信扫二维码连接wifi 微信连wifi使用方法?

    微信连wifi使用方法?1、再次进入WiFi连接可以设置,找不到要连接到的WiFi热点名称,再点连接。2、通过连接到的WiFi热点象没有密码,在连接成功了后会在浏览器跳回一个认证页面。3、进入验正页面会不提示通过认证,然后就照做提示操作就可

  5. 5 如何设置火狐浏览器让mailto链接使用360安全浏览器处理

    在今天的网络世界中,浏览器是我们上网必不可少的工具之一。每个人都有自己偏好的浏览器,比如火狐浏览器就是备受欢迎的选项之一。但是,有时候我们希望能够让特定的操作使用其他浏览器来处理,比如让mailto链接使用360安全浏览器来打开。下面就让我

  6. 6 回收站的文件删不了怎么办

    在日常使用电脑的过程中,回收站是我们常常需要使用到的功能之一。然而,有时候我们可能会遇到这样的问题:回收站中的文件无法被删除,即使使用了常规的删除方法,这些文件仍然留在电脑中。面对这种情况,我们应该如何解决呢?下面将为您提供几种常见的解决方

  7. 7 Excel工资表操作技巧:自动添加货币符号

    初识Excel中的货币符号在编辑Excel工资表时,添加货币符号是必不可少的操作。货币符号的引入可以使数据更直观清晰,让阅读者一目了然地看出金额数值。那么,在Excel中如何实现在工资表中自动添加货币符号呢?接下来将介绍两种简单实用的方法

  8. 8 如何下载我的世界PC版

    我的世界是一款备受欢迎的沙盒游戏,拥有极高的自由度和趣味的支线版本,让许多玩家无法自拔。如果你也想尝试这款游戏,下面将为你介绍如何下载我的世界PC版。步骤1:打开浏览器搜索我的世界官网首先,打开一台电脑,并进入任意一款浏览器。在搜索栏中输入

  9. 9 蜜源app真能省钱吗 蜜源APP省钱效果如何

    蜜源APP近年来在移动互联网市场上备受瞩目,它被标榜为一个能够帮助用户省钱的神器。那么,蜜源APP究竟能否实现其所宣传的省钱效果呢?本文将从多个论点出发,详细探讨这个问题。首先,蜜源APP提供了丰富的优惠信息,用户可以在应用中找到各类商品的

  10. 10 uc浏览器里的小说删除了之后在哪 uc浏览器怎么听故事?

    uc浏览器怎么听故事?讲故事的办法::1.简单再打开手机中的UC浏览器,在首页上方点击【小说】再次进入书城;2.再次进入小说内之后,在“书城”页面下滑不能找到【听书专区】直接进入听书专区;3.接着选择类型一本自己打算听书的小说,点击进入小说

Copyright 2025 优质自媒体,让大家了解更多图文资讯!百度地图 360地图